Wednesday morning my Girlfriend had went to the dentist, and decided to go by the house to check on things, and found two guys had broken in to the house. One pulled a gun on her, and demand that she tell them where I hide my weapons. (don't have any in that house due to her distaste for guns)
She told them that we didn't have any in the house. They tore througn all my duffle bags looking for one. Seeing all my slings, mag's, and hoisters, they just knew I had some hidden somewhere.
This went on for over an hour. Since these two low lifes were a foot decide that they want to take my Dodge Ram SRT 10 to haul off all our TV's, computers, and anything else they could fill the back of it with. She told them she didn't know where the keys to the truck was since I was the only one who drove it. They looked inside it, but wasn't smart enough to know that when you open the door and the dinger is sounding, "the Keys are in the ignition".
They ended up loading eveything they could into my girlfriends Mini Cooper clubman. (she had to educate him how to start the thing since in uses a remote that slide into the dash, and you push a starter button)
They taped her up on one of the bar chairs in the middle of the kitchen floor, and drove out of the garage. then they went back in and ask her where the remote is for the garage door.
we got lucky in so many ways.
1. They didn't harm her during the whole ordeal (Physically anyways)
2. They didn't make off with anything that can't be replaced
3. The OKCPD found the Mini Cooper this morning
4. They didn't make off with my 2004 SRT 10 with 20K on the Odometer.
So now the big question
Does anyone use Lojac car security and tracking system?
